The next 4 games

Since I did such a fantastic job in THIS THREAD calling the 6-3 record after the 49er loss, I figured I would offer my next 4 game prediction.


Vs Sea
@ Oak
Vs Den
@Ari

Strangely enough the game I'm most confident about is the Seattle game. I think Seattle isn't playing very good ball right now. That coupled with the Chiefs being on a roll and at home I think we go to 7-3.

The next three I'm not so sure. All of them are beatable teams I just get this feeling that we only come out of this stretch 8-5. Oakland could be very dangerous if they don't pick up a win before then. Denver is Denver, game could go either way if the Chiefs can play ball control offense they have a good shot to win. Arizona looks tough. But as of this writing the Rams D is dominating 'Zona right now.
